Interstate Brick is widely recognized as one of the premier
commercial brick manufacturers in the U.S. Established in 1891,
Interstate Brick joined the Pacific Coast Building Products family
in 1990. The company's products, used in residential and commercial
construction, offer several distinguishing features that motivate
architects and builders across the country to specify them.
